How tall is the kid, and how tall is he likely to be? The Cosmic is a great value-for-money bike if you're going to have to look at moving him up to a 26" bike in about two years. Both my boys grew out of 24" bikes by age 12.

My son turned 10 in May, but is small for his age. Weight = 25kg and 1.3m tall - so very small. I opted for the Momsen JSL40 (24") - weight is 10.3kg. It's a great buy. He can handle & control the bike. It has an air shock and very good components. We've done a couple of rides at groenkloof doing 300m ascent in 15km and he can peddle it up hill. That was important to me. For a small kid to peddle a 12 or 13kg bike uphill is tough and then the enjoyment fades. Not to speak about pushing the same bike uphill if he / she cannot ride it.

 

My advise is... go to the shops and see how your son fits onto a XS 26" bike. I looked at many XS 26" bikes and they were just to heavy (entry level bikes - I didn't want to spend a fortune) and big for my son to be comfortable on them. I'll rather "waste" money with the 24" and let him ride it for 2 years and have 2 years of enjoyment vs. struggling and loosing interest. But, for a bigger 10yr old I would probably have gone for the XS 26". I see the gradual migration from 20" to 24" and eventually to 26" as an investment in time with my son. Money well spend :-)

 

So, again my advice is: go do some measuring and fitting and see what he'll be comfortable with vs. what you would like to get him :-).

One 'bad thing' about 24" is that you don't get foldable tyres in a 1.75 range which means you cannot convert to tubeless. We did a ride the other day and got a puncture... Eventualy the 'green tube slime' did seal, but not without hassles. Afterwards I wanted to fix the tube as it was still losing pressure and it has 8 punctures :-(

I would love to be able to convert to tubeless!!
